The primary thing to consider for plasmid purification is separation of plasmid DNA from the chromosomal DNA and cellular RNA with the host bacteria. Many techniques are already formulated to produce a cleared lysate that not only eliminate protein and lipids, but additionally competently get rid of contaminating chromosomal DNA whilst leaving plasmid DNA free in solution.

So as to conduct in-the-area detection of retrovirus, a way have to be made to extract viral RNA working with a straightforward, dependable and rapid procedure devoid of obtain to standard laboratory products. In-the-discipline detection of bacterial genomic DNA by heating samples at 95 °C is documented Formerly (Belgrader et al., 1999). This technique can't be used for detecting RNA virus mainly because RNase, which rapidly destroys RNA molecules, is steady and purposeful at ninety five °C. Moreover, the reverse transcription reaction is more liable to the interference via the contaminated proteins than is the standard PCR response.
